Sensors have become integral to a variety of electronic applications, enabling devices to interact with their environment. From smart home technology to industrial automation, the role of sensors is crucial in providing data and enabling functionalities.
Smart devices are reshaping how we interact with technology. Sensors facilitate features that respond to user behavior, making devices smarter and more intuitive. For instance, temperature sensors in smart thermostats allow for energy-efficient heating and cooling.
Industries such as healthcare, automotive, and manufacturing are increasingly adopting sensor technology. In healthcare, wearable sensors track vital signs, while automotive sensors contribute to safety and navigation systems.
While the growth of sensors presents numerous opportunities, challenges such as data privacy and security must be addressed. Innovators are continuously working on solutions to ensure that sensor data is both valuable and secure.
Sensors are undeniably shaping the future of electronic applications. As technology continues to evolve, understanding their significance will be crucial for businesses aiming to remain competitive in the marketplace.
